Authority Zero is a punk rock band from Mesa, Arizona. Their sound blends elements of skate punk and reggae, with significant influences from Bad Religion, Pennywise, and Sublime. The band's music also features an apparent Spanish/Portuguese influence. Formed in 1998, they are known for their energetic live performances and dedicated fan base. Some of their most representative songs include "The Last Time", "My Own Way" and "What I've Become".
